Training Programme Participation

Training Programme Participation

This category covers participation in short courses, workshops, and training sessions on topics relevant to business and management education. These may be delivered by your institution, Chartered ABS, or other recognised organisations. 

Technology and skills-based training 
Many CMBEs have attended workshops on topics including blended learning, AI in education, or inclusive teaching. If you have acquired new skills and applied them in your practice, you can log this activity with an attendance certificate and a reflection on implementation. 

External development opportunities 
Participation in external training, such as workshops on assessment and feedback or student engagement strategies, can be recorded. Reflecting on how these insights have shaped your teaching or leadership enhances the validity of your CPD claim. 

Maximum hours claimable per year: 20 hours 

Examples of verifiable evidence: Certificate of attendance / Copy of signed register
